Herbalife Ltd. (NYSE:HLF - Get Free Report) shares fell 3.9% during trading on Tuesday . The stock traded as low as $7.36 and last traded at $7.40. 130,393 shares changed hands during mid-day trading, a decline of 94% from the average session volume of 2,234,802 shares. The stock had previously closed at $7.70.

Herbalife Price Performance
The company has a 50-day moving average of $7.15 and a two-hundred day moving average of $7.18. The company has a market capitalization of $787.18 million, a PE ratio of 3.10, a P/E/G ratio of 0.29 and a beta of 0.86.
Herbalife (NYSE:HLF - Get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ings data on Wednesday, April 30th. The company reported $0.59 earnings per share for the quarter, beating analysts' consensus estimates of $0.40 by $0.19. The firm had revenue of $1.22 billion for the quarter, compared to analysts' expectations of $1.23 billion. Herbalife had a negative return on equity of 20.78% and a net margin of 5.09%. The business's quarterly revenue was down 3.4% on a year-over-year basis. During the same period in the previous year, the firm earned $0.49 EPS. As a group, research analysts anticipate that Herbalife Ltd. will post 1.57 EPS for the current year.
Insiders Place Their Bets
In other Herbalife news, Director Juan Miguel Mendoza bought 5,000 shares of the business's stock in a transaction that occurred on Thursday, May 22nd. The stock was purchased at an average price of $6.75 per share, for a total transaction of $33,750.00. Following the completion of the transaction, the director now owns 166,857 shares of the company's stock, valued at $1,126,284.75. This trade represents a 3.09% increase in their position. The transaction was disclosed in a document filed with the SEC, which is available through this hyperlink. Company insiders own 1.73% of the company's stock.

Herbalife Ltd. provides health and wellness products in North America, Mexico, South and Central America, Europe, the Middle East, Africa, China, and the Asia Pacific. It offers products in the areas of weight management; targeted nutrition; energy, sports, and fitness; outer nutrition; and literature and promotional items.
